Abela,Craig
Craig Abela
Standard and Technical Pilot
Pacific Air Express Australia
Craig Abela is a professional Standards and Technical Pilot qualified on Boeing 757/767/777/787 and Airbus A320 series aircraft.

Serving 15 years in the Royal New Zealand Air Force, mostly flying Boeing 757 aircraft; Craig’s resume includes: military Boeing 757 display pilot, Instructor, Heads of State Pilot and Antarctica project lead pilot (Captaining the first Boeing commercial airliner to conduct Antarctic operations).

Craig served 5 years with Air New Zealand as a jet recruiter and Standards pilot (instructor) on Boeing 777s and Airbus aircraft. He was recruited by Pacific Air Express Australia in 2017 as a Standards and Technical Pilot in order to lead them through the Australian Air Operators Certificate (AOC) process. Craig has set up the Electronic Flight Bag (EFB) system for the Boeing 757 fleet, Required Navigation Performance (RNP) approvals and other associated flight technical approvals for global flight operations. The Australian AOC process was accomplished in December 2018.

Craig holds a Bachelor of Aviation amongst other military and civilian regulatory qualifications.

de Moor,Sander
Sander de Moor
Director Airline Efficiency and Fuel Efficiency Team Lead
Aircraft Commerce Consulting
A licensed flight dispatcher with 30+ years’ experience in all areas of flight operations support, Sander has fully specialised in fuel and operational efficiency strategies since 2007. For 2 years he was a core member of the IATA Green Teams, helping to shape that program. He then developed further enhancements to these programs and processes to deliver successful Fuel Efficiency programs at various airlines where he was in charge of Fuel Efficiency, including LOT Polish Airlines (2011-2013), Etihad Airways (2013-2016), Air Serbia (2016) and Air Seychelles (2016). In recent years, he has worked with a leading Fuel Efficiency Software Vendor as an airline consultant and since 2017 in support of Efficiency & Performance topics on behalf of Aircraft Commerce Consulting. Currently he is producing the aircraft performance interactivity of the new Aircraft Analytics venture.

Sander is a regular speaker at industry leading events regarding establishing, delivering and enhancing Fuel Efficiency programs, and his workshops are well attended.

Noon,Glenn
Glenn Noon
Senior Consultant – Engineering IT Systems
Aircraft Commerce Consulting
In nearly 40 years, Glen has gained a reputation for integrity, problem-solving, professionalism, depth of knowledge and perseverance. Starting in 1978 as a Royal Navy aircraft engineer, with fixed and rotary wing aircraft, he rose to manage the British Military’s first Aircraft Management System.

Glen joined Computer Science Corporation in 2000, working with GKN Westlands & Lockheed Martin UKIS to deliver MSSAS logistical solution for the Merlin, later working with Lockheed Aeronautics, managing an Asset Management tool supporting C130J assets for global users. He joined XL Airways in 2006 and implemented AMOS for three Group companies before, as a consultant, joining easyJet to assist their AMOS implementation.

Glen’s next project at BMI meant working on both MRO and Flight Operations solutions, and in the sale of the Airline. British Airways Next Generation project for the induction of the B787 and A380’s connected Aircraft followed, before, in 2013, moving to consult with Etihad Airways on their Entry into Service project. Having delivered an MRO Solution for the e-Enabled fleet plus built up and led a Technical Competency Center, Glen left Etihad Airways in 2017 for Europe and clients including Vueling Airways and Flybe.

Glen continues to apply, across a wide spectrum of aviation clients, his deep understanding of aircraft, component maintenance, e- Enablement, IT systems and problem-solving.

Riegler,Michael
Michael Riegler
Manager Innovation and Support
Quantas
Michael has 30 years’ experience in aviation industry. First as an air traffic control officer in the Royal Australian Air force, then a variety of roles in a 22-year career working for Qantas, including roles in Load Control, Flight Dispatch and Flight Dispatch Systems.
System analysis and development has consumed the last ten years of Michael’s career. Michael managed the Dispatch Systems business area and from here Championed the business case to replace an aging mainframe flight planning system.
Michael had various leadership roles in the numerous phases of the flight planning system replacement project. Much of Michael’s time and energy was spent as manager aeronautical information management for the flight planning future project in Qantas Flight Operations. This role was integral in pulling together the end to end flight planning solution.
As of August 2018 Michael, has taken up the new role of Manager Innovation and Support in Flight Operations overseeing the commissioning of the system and fleet roll out that culminated in the successful cutover of the final B737 fleet in June 2019.
